The Great Wildebeest Migration begins in Kenya

The annual wildebeest migration, a natural phenomenon which sees around 1.5 million wildebeest on the move in East Africa, has begun in Kenya as the herds move northwards after crossing the Mara River. A spectacular natural wonder, the migration takes … Continue reading

1000 year-old Crusader treasure unearthed in Israel

Israeli archaeologists have located a 1000 year-old hoard of gold coins, unearthed at a famous Crusader battleground where Christian and Muslim forces fought for control of the Holy Land. Over 100 coins dating back to the time of the crusader … Continue reading
